Self-Published Kids BookChildren are delightful. Children are funny. Children – and boys in particular – seem to never sit still!

The goal of this book was to take some fun rhyming text, match it up with some lively illustrations and share with the reader (and the read-to) a day in the life of one little boy and his rabbit sidekick. If you smile or giggle or think for one second, “I can relate to that!” then our goal has been achieved.

We’ve been thrilled to receive wonderful testimonials and reviews so far for the book – as The Midwest Book Review said this year, “‘The Boy Who Wouldn’t Sit Still‘ is a delightful book about a boy whom most of us know already (and love). What makes ‘The Boy Who Wouldn’t Sit Still‘ so charming and unusual is the innocent literalness of his responses to others in his life. It is a wonderful book for kids 3 and up and parents, caretakers and teachers of kids age 3 and up. Even girls like it!
